Calculation method for determining air consumption of air compressor
The traditional method of determining the compressed air requirements of a new plant is to add up the air consumption (m³/min) of all air-consuming equipment, and then consider adding a safety, leakage and development factor.

What you need to know about the electrical connection of Copeland refrigeration compressors
Please pay attention to the direction of the terminals in the junction box (single-phase: R, S, C; three-phase: T1, T2, T3). In order to ensure the normal start-up and operation of the Copeland refrigeration compressor, the power supply voltage cannot be lower than 10% of the Copeland compressor rated voltage.
